Price based indicators compare price to price_trend, (not price to price). I'm not aware of anything offering a more optimal divergence signal than divergence from trend.

 

Under the topic, "The Physics of Price," consider that price is an object propelled by a force. With that as a given then a more optimal divergence would be a divergence between the path of the object and the magnitude of the force.

 

What you are talking about is a difference between the object and its path with no consideration of motivation.

+1 for diverging instead of confirmed divergence – regardless of between what measures the diverge is occurring. In all my years, I've heard very little comment (or posts) re the concept of diverging. I admire your perspectives...

 

Rationally, fully formed divergences look safer. In real life, they aren’t.

In the limited market conditions where I utilize diverg., the tested odds of payoff are better for my diverging setups than they are for fully formed divergences – even if I’m using a very short right strength on the pivots. So now in all mkt conditions where diverg is utilized, I go ahead and start building the position using diverging instead of divergence … tactical fitness…

btw, using diverging as we speak real time, just starting to cover some of the EUR shorts I put on last week (fwiw, it will probably be 24+ hours before the positions are fully unwound though...)

 

Do you use classical pivots for all but the current swing or does your method for measuring diverging not use pivots at all? Thanks.

Great to see a fellow divergence trader. In every book and on internet I see the people going by the conventional way to confirm consecutive pivots, but by the time it is confirmed the risk/reward is already screwed.

 

"Do you use classical pivots for all but the current swing or does your method for measuring diverging not use pivots at all?"

 

See the attached example, I use the classic pivot in prices which may or may not correspond to the pivot in oscillator (the blue spike in lower pane indicates divergence). The typical entry is when market cuts the high of previous bar.

While we trade in much faster time frames than most of the references here, this morning, in ES, there was a classic double positive divergece in both the 8k & 5k volume bar charts.

 

As everybody here knows we believe that divergences between price and the buying and selling forces that propels price can often indicate change.

 

In the middle of the chart below you can see that as price (top window) makes a Lower Low, both the indicator of net trade and the indicator of the moving window of the balance of trade made Higher Lows which is referenced as a double positive divergence.

 

This divergence was verified and duplicated in the 8k chart:
